‘Botox Bandit’ Arrested for “Stealing” Aesthetic Services in Florida

Police in Miami Beach recently nabbed Maria Elizabeth Chrysson, also known locally as the “Botox Bandit,” for not paying for over $4000 worth of liposuction treatments at a south Florida plastic surgery center.

According to the South Florida Sun-Sentinel, Chrysson was writing bad checks to cover for the treatments and even walking out of the office without paying on a couple of occasions. She was arrested at a Latin café in Miami Beach…complaining about a “bad hair day,” Chrysson was especially worried about how her mug shot would appear.

Chrysson’s lawyer, Daniel Lurvey, says “We were in the process of making restitution when the arrest occurred. We will continue to attempt to resolve the matter of the alleged victim.”

The infamous “Botox Bandit” has been charged three counts of grand theft and one count of scheming to defraud.

In addition to the arrest, Chrysson is also being investigated for a similar situation at a plastic surgery center in Ft. Lauderdale where it’s alleged she walked out and neglected to pay a $3300 bill for 50 Botox injections.

A Miami-Dade judge has ordered Chrysson to remain under house arrest and wear and ankle monitor until her trial.

The “Botox Bandit” was notoriously more concerned with appearances than with the seriousness of the charges according to officers. She inquired several times about logging into her Facebook page to see if anyone knew she had been arrested.
